Average & Adjusted Average Forecasting Calculator
Calculate simple averages and weighted adjusted averages for more accurate forecasting
Forecast Results
Comprehensive Guide to Calculating Average and Adjusted Average Forecasting
Forecasting is a critical business function that helps organizations make informed decisions about future operations, financial planning, and resource allocation. While simple averages provide a basic prediction method, adjusted averages incorporate weighting factors to account for the relative importance of different data points, typically giving more weight to recent observations.
Understanding Simple Averages
The simple average (arithmetic mean) is calculated by summing all values in a dataset and dividing by the number of values:
Simple Average = (Σxᵢ) / n
Where xᵢ = individual values, n = number of values
For example, if you have quarterly sales of [120, 135, 140, 155, 160], the simple average would be:
- Sum all values: 120 + 135 + 140 + 155 + 160 = 710
- Divide by number of periods: 710 / 5 = 142
The simple average forecast for the next period would be 142 units.
The Limitations of Simple Averages
While simple averages are easy to calculate, they have several limitations for forecasting:
- Equal weighting: All historical data points contribute equally to the forecast, regardless of their age or relevance
- Lagging indicator: The forecast reacts slowly to recent changes in the data pattern
- No trend consideration: Doesn’t account for upward or downward trends in the data
- Sensitive to outliers: Extreme values can disproportionately affect the average
Introducing Adjusted Averages
Adjusted averages (also called weighted averages) address these limitations by applying different weights to different data points. The formula becomes:
Adjusted Average = Σ(wᵢ × xᵢ)
Where wᵢ = weight for each value, xᵢ = individual values, and Σwᵢ = 1
Common weighting schemes include:
| Weighting Method | Description | Example Weights (5 periods) | Best For |
|---|---|---|---|
| Linear Decreasing | Weights decrease linearly from newest to oldest | [0.35, 0.25, 0.20, 0.15, 0.05] | Data with clear trends |
| Exponential Decreasing | Weights decrease exponentially (e.g., halving each period) | [0.50, 0.25, 0.125, 0.0625, 0.0625] | Volatile data with recent changes |
| Custom Weights | User-defined weights based on domain knowledge | [0.40, 0.30, 0.20, 0.07, 0.03] | Specialized forecasting needs |
| Seasonal Weights | Higher weights for same-period historical data | Varies by seasonality pattern | Seasonal business cycles |
When to Use Adjusted Averages
Adjusted averages are particularly valuable in these scenarios:
Trending Data
When your data shows a clear upward or downward trend, giving more weight to recent observations will make your forecast more responsive to the current direction.
Volatile Markets
In industries with frequent changes (like technology or fashion), recent data points are more predictive of future performance than older ones.
Seasonal Patterns
For businesses with seasonal cycles (retail, agriculture), you can assign higher weights to the same season from previous years.
Step-by-Step Calculation Process
- Gather historical data: Collect at least 5-10 relevant data points. More data generally improves accuracy but may require more complex weighting.
- Choose weighting method: Select linear, exponential, or custom weights based on your data characteristics and business needs.
- Normalize weights: Ensure all weights sum to 1.0. For example, if using linear weights for 5 periods: [5,4,3,2,1] becomes [0.33, 0.27, 0.20, 0.13, 0.07].
- Apply weights: Multiply each data point by its corresponding weight.
- Sum weighted values: Add all the weighted values together to get your adjusted average forecast.
- Validate results: Compare with simple average and domain knowledge to ensure reasonableness.
Real-World Application Example
Let’s examine a practical example using quarterly sales data for an e-commerce business:
| Quarter | Sales ($) | Linear Weight | Weighted Value |
|---|---|---|---|
| Q1 2023 | 125,000 | 0.10 | 12,500 |
| Q2 2023 | 132,000 | 0.15 | 19,800 |
| Q3 2023 | 145,000 | 0.20 | 29,000 |
| Q4 2023 | 180,000 | 0.25 | 45,000 |
| Q1 2024 | 160,000 | 0.30 | 48,000 |
| Totals | 742,000 | 1.00 | 154,300 |
Calculations:
- Simple Average: 742,000 / 5 = $148,400
- Adjusted Average: $154,300 (sum of weighted values)
- Difference: +$5,900 (4% higher than simple average)
The adjusted average suggests slightly higher expected sales for Q2 2024, reflecting the recent upward trend in the business.
Advanced Considerations
Weight Optimization
For critical forecasts, you can use optimization techniques to determine the weights that minimize historical forecast errors. This requires more advanced statistical methods.
Confidence Intervals
Calculate prediction intervals (e.g., ±10%) to express the uncertainty in your forecast. This helps decision-makers understand the range of possible outcomes.
Combination Forecasts
Some organizations combine simple and adjusted averages (or multiple adjusted averages) to create hybrid forecasts that balance responsiveness with stability.
Common Mistakes to Avoid
- Overfitting weights: Creating overly complex weighting schemes that work perfectly on historical data but fail to predict future values.
- Ignoring data quality: Using adjusted averages won’t help if your input data contains errors or inconsistencies.
- Neglecting weight normalization: Forgetting to ensure weights sum to 1.0 will produce incorrect results.
- Static weighting: Using the same weights indefinitely without periodically reviewing their appropriateness.
- Overlooking external factors: Adjusted averages only consider historical patterns, not external market changes or one-time events.
Tools and Software for Forecasting
While manual calculations work for simple cases, most businesses use specialized tools:
- Spreadsheets: Excel and Google Sheets have built-in averaging functions and can handle basic weighted averages
- Statistical Software: R, Python (with pandas/numpy), and SPSS offer advanced forecasting capabilities
- Business Intelligence: Tools like Tableau and Power BI include forecasting features
- ERP Systems: Enterprise resource planning systems often have integrated forecasting modules
- Specialized Forecasting: Dedicated tools like SAS Forecasting or IBM Planning Analytics
Industry-Specific Applications
Retail
Adjusted averages help retailers forecast demand for seasonal products, with higher weights given to same-season data from previous years.
Manufacturing
Manufacturers use weighted averages to predict raw material needs, giving more importance to recent production trends.
Finance
Financial institutions apply adjusted averages to predict market movements, with exponential weighting for volatile instruments.
Healthcare
Hospitals use weighted patient volume forecasts to optimize staffing, with different weights for weekdays vs. weekends.
Academic Research and Authority Sources
Frequently Asked Questions
How many data points should I use?
Aim for at least 5-10 data points. More data can improve accuracy but may require more complex weighting. The optimal number depends on your data’s volatility and seasonality.
Can weights be negative?
While mathematically possible, negative weights are rarely used in business forecasting as they’re difficult to interpret. All weights should typically be between 0 and 1.
How often should I update my weights?
Review weights quarterly or when you notice significant changes in your data patterns. Some organizations use rolling windows where the oldest data point drops off as new data arrives.
What’s better: linear or exponential weighting?
Exponential weighting reacts more strongly to recent changes, making it better for volatile data. Linear weighting provides a more balanced approach for stable trends.
Conclusion and Best Practices
Mastering average and adjusted average forecasting provides a powerful tool for data-driven decision making. Remember these key takeaways:
- Start with simple averages to establish a baseline
- Choose weighting methods that match your data characteristics
- Always normalize weights to sum to 1.0
- Validate forecasts against actual results and adjust weights as needed
- Combine quantitative forecasts with qualitative insights from domain experts
- Document your methodology for consistency and audit purposes
- Consider using specialized software for complex forecasting needs
By understanding both the mathematical foundations and practical applications of these forecasting techniques, you can significantly improve your organization’s planning accuracy and operational efficiency.